The DCS Ombudsman Bureau was created in 2009 by the Indiana State Legislature. The Bureau has the authority to receive, investigate and attempt to resolve complaints concerning the actions of the Department of Child Services (DCS) and to make recommendations to improve the child welfare system. This policy outlines the steps and precautions that DCS staff should take before initiating an assessment of a report of child abuse or neglect. It covers topics such as safety, interview planning, language services, domestic violence, human trafficking, and joint assessments. The Indiana Department of Child Services (DCS) will ensure every Preliminary Report of Alleged Child Abuse or Neglect (310) is screened for the presence of DV.
